Maine Community Foundation Keepers Preservation Education Fund

Do you know about the outstanding Keepers Preservation Education Fund? Maine Community Foundation is pleasingly offering its exclusive Keepers Preservation Education Fund. This program is open to students enrolled full or part-time in higher learning institutions with majors in historic preservation or allied fields. Candidates from anywhere in the United States can apply for the funds. Maine Community Foundation members or their family members are eligible to apply.

The Keepers Preservation Education Fund offers financial resources to aspiring or trained conservation professionals in the United States to enhance or share their professional knowledge or develop their career prospects in historical preservation-related subjects. These funds reduce the students’ financial burden and make their educational journey easy and help them complete their career goals. The Scholarship is easy to access and provides tremendous benefits.

William J. Murtagh established the Keepers Preservation Education Funds in the year 1988. William J. Murtagh is a leading and world-known historic preservation. He was an outstanding writer, educator, speaker, and executive at the National Trust for many years. Who May Be Eligible?

To eligible for this Scholarship, the candidates must be following all the eligibility criteria:

  • Fellows to be eligible should be enrolled full or part-time in higher learning
  • Candidates from anywhere in the United States can apply.
  • Fellows should not be members of the awards committee or the family of a committee member.

How to Apply

Fellows cannot apply directly; they need to approach a sponsoring institute or organization and apply it through them. Candidates can apply by seeking institutional sponsorship through their university or college in which they are enrolled. The sponsor institute will assess the candidate’s eligibility and submit the recommendation application for the funding. Please inform your sponsoring institution to submit all the required information and materials to efickett@mainecf.org  or send them to

Keepers Preservation Education Fund
Maine Community Foundation
245 Main Street
Ellsworth, ME 04605.

Supporting Documents

  • Please submit a one-page statement explaining your need for funds. In this statement, please include Your name, address, email address, and phone number. Along with the statement, write an explanation of your relationship with the sponsoring organization.
  • A statement of total funds needed to support the project/activity, itemized by budget category, should be provided.
  • An updated resume is needed.
  • Please provide the name, address and phone number of the institution. The name of the contact person coordinates the sponsorship of the application by the organization with his or her identity, email address, and phone number.

Benefits

These funds give enough support to the students to complete their education without stressAwards can be used for tuition, professional events, special books or other forms of media purchases, domestic and international study trips and other purposes. This program reduces the considerable financial burden from the candidates and makes education easy for them.

Application Deadline

Applications are reviewed on a rolling basis. Please inform your sponsors to send applications at least three months in advance of actual need.
